Bayer agrees to $7.25B Roundup class-action settlement - Breitbart
Summary
Bayer has agreed to a $7.25 billion settlement to resolve a class-action lawsuit alleging that its Roundup weedkiller caused cancer. The settlement will establish a fund to cover existing and future claims from individuals diagnosed with non-Hodgkin lymphoma, a type of blood cancer, after exposure to Roundup. Bayer’s CEO, Bill Anderson, stated the agreement provides “an essential path out of the litigation uncertainty” and allows the company to focus on innovation.
The settlement includes a separate case, Durnell, currently before the Supreme Court. Monsanto, a Bayer subsidiary and the producer of Roundup, will make annual payments into the settlement fund over the next 21 years. Importantly, Monsanto does not admit wrongdoing but agreed to the settlement to resolve tens of thousands of lawsuits and prevent future claims.
The settlement applies to individuals exposed to Roundup before Tuesday who have already been diagnosed with non-Hodgkin lymphoma or receive a diagnosis within 16 years of the settlement’s final approval.
